#e0ffd3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e0ffd3 is composed of 87.8% red, 100% green and 82.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.3%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 102.3 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 91.4%. #e0ffd3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c1ffa7.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#e0ffd3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e0ffd3 has RGB values of R:224, G:255, B:211 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0. Its decimal value is 14745555.
